Responsibilities

The Digital Delivery Systems Manager leads the Design Production function inside the Design & Engineering Department at Brasfield & Gorrie and owns the systems it runs on. This role is responsible for structural plan production and for the design technology behind it - the workspace, templates, standards, content, and automation that turn structural engineering into coordinated, construction-ready plan sets.

Position Summary

The role leads two functions:
Structural Plan Production (Revit-based drawing production and BIM coordination) and Design Technology (templates, standards, content libraries, and automation). The Digital Delivery Systems Manager is the primary operating link between engineering demand and production capacity, and supports engineering deliverables issued under a professional seal, maintaining design intent through every revision and issue cycle.

Responsibilities and Essential Duties include the following (other duties may be assigned) Design Technology & Production Systems
  • Develop and own the department’s structural plan production system:
    Revit workspace, project templates, shared parameters, family and detail libraries, note libraries, and schedule-ready content.
  • Develop and maintain automation tools that improve production speed, consistency, and sheet quality.
  • Own the production quality control process and its documentation standards, including checking procedures, issue-set control, revision discipline, and version management.
  • Own the model coordination protocol with the VDC department across design and issuance milestones, including a disciplined process for incorporating field-driven changes without compromising contract documents.
  • Evaluate and recommend new tools, workflows, automations, and technologies that improve production efficiency, drawing quality, or engineering-to-production handoff.
  • Partner with the VDC department and IT on software licensing, version management, and integration with Autodesk Construction Cloud and related platforms.
Production Operations & Team Leadership
  • Lead day-to-day plan production operations including how work enters the team, how it is prioritized and staffed, and how deliverables are issued.
  • Guide, develop, and support production staff including contributing to hiring and onboarding as the function grows.
  • Maintain a team culture aligned with the department’s standards: accuracy, ownership, and constructability awareness.
Engineering Interface & Capacity Planning
  • Serve as the primary operating link between the engineering practices (Vertical Design, Construction Engineering) and the Design Production team.
  • Align production capacity to engineering demand by forecasting upcoming work, surfacing constraints early, and keeping delivery moving without interrupting engineering workflow.
  • Attend project kickoffs and milestone reviews to represent the Design Production team’s scope, timeline, and delivery requirements.
  • Coordinate with Senior Engineers and Discipline Engineers on drawing release schedules, revision sequencing, and production quality expectations.
  • Develop cost estimates and production schedule for plan production activities
Delivery Quality & Standards
  • Own the quality of all Design Production output. Drawing sets must be accurate, coordinated, and construction-ready before issuance.
  • Maintain design intent through the document lifecycle by ensuring that sheets, schedules, and details accurately reflect the engineering design through every revision and issue cycle.
  • Enforce department drawing standards, BIM execution requirements, and QC checkpoints consistently across the team.
  • Identify and resolve production bottlenecks, coordination gaps, and recurring quality issues before they reach the engineering team or project team.
  • Maintain version control, file management, and documentation discipline across all active projects in the production queue.
